- FUNCTION: Catalyzes the first step in the oxidation of the side chain of sterol intermediates; the 27-hydroxylation of 5-beta-cholestane-3-alpha,7-alpha,12-alpha-triol. Has also a vitamin D3-25-hydroxylase activity.
- CATALYTIC ACTIVITY: 5-beta-cholestane-3-alpha,7-alpha,12-alpha-triol + NADPH + O2 = (25R)-5-beta-cholestane-3-alpha,7-alpha,12-alpha,26-tetraol + NADP+ + H2O.
- COFACTOR: Heme group (By similarity).
- PATHWAY: Hormone biosynthesis; cholecalciferol biosynthesis.
- SUBCELLULAR LOCATION: Mitochondrion membrane.
- TISSUE SPECIFICITY: Expressed in liver, hepatoma, kidney, ovary and epithelial cells of blood vessels.
- SIMILARITY: Belongs to the cytochrome P450 family.
